Bushey Meads Senior Maths Challenge Awards

On Tuesday 6th November 2018 a selection of top students from Years 12 and 13 participated in the UKMT Senior Maths Challenge. It is a 90 minute multiple choice paper consisting of interesting questions designed to inspire and test problem solving skills. To obtain a certificate students must have a sound grasp of mathematical concepts and be able to think outside the box in order to solve unfamiliar problems, which are also valuable skills for success in STEM subjects and STEM related careers.
